Frequently asked questions
Are your paintings on fabric guaranteed to be colourfast?
Nope! I cannot guarantee anything as there are too many variant that could contradict this but, in my process, I have tested my method by washing in a very hot machine cycle was and dryer cycle (hot too!) and my paintings came out practically the same! The only different is that the edges were very frayed and the fabric, which is 100% cotton, had shrunk so a 14ct aida was now a 15ct one. I no longer do the full machine wash and dry cycles for those reason but each piece is washed and ironed multiple times before they are listed so I am pretty confident about my process.
The paints I use are professional quality, highly pigmented, watercolours. A fabric medium is used to seal the micro-pigment particles into the fabric.
